
INTRODUCTION

Kenyans overwhelmingly ushered in our current constitution on the promise of devolution which they felt result in increased grass root
access to resources and political power. Indeed people’s expectations of county governments continue to be extremely high.
While most county governments tend appreciate this fact and try to capitalize on low hanging fruits as soon as they kick off, others prefer to spend the nascent stages laying the ground work and planning elaborately for delivery. Irrespective of leadership styles may differ, what
is critical is for people to feel the impact of devolution in their daily lives.
County governments need to fully decipher the perceptions of their residents and develop strategies that are concomitant with their
expectations.
It’s against this back drop that Infotrak Research developed the CountyTrak™ Performance Index to provide Citizens’ Scorecard of
their County governments against set key performance indicators.
The CountyTrak™ Methodology
The CountyTrak Methodology
- Our current index was conducted between July– August 2023, covering all the 47 counties,
290 constituencies and 1450 wards with an overall sample of 36,200. Each county was treated
as an individual universe and assigned a cluster sample which ranged between 600 and 2000
respondents guided by the population and number of wards in the respective counties. Within
each county, sampling frames were designed using population proportionate to size guided by
census data and catered for demographics such as age, gender etc. Data was collected
through Computer Assisted Telephone Interviews (CATI) and analysed using SPSS.
- The CountyTrak tool consisted of twelve core functions with thirty three key performance
indicators and five approval rating questions. The functions included: Agriculture, Health,
Education, Roads & Transport, Energy, Water management, Environment & natural resources
management, Trade & Tourism, County Planning & Development, Housing, Lands & settlement,
Culture & Sports and Social Services. Also covered was Public Participation, Planning, and
Management of County Resources. - The final questionnaire was structured with using 1-10 Likert scale being applied on each
indicator where 1 was very poor and 10 was excellent. The mean was computed for each Sub-
Indicator of the Key Performance Indicators (KPI) to get the Index for that Specific KPI. The
Overall County performance Index was then computed by taking the average of the KPIs.
This Index is the first of its kind and magnitude in Kenya. It provides the county governments and other
interested stakeholders with robust statistics by ward on the perception of county residents over county
governments’ performance of the devolved functions.
